Quantum cryptography represents a significant leap forward in securing data transmission. By utilizing the principles of quantum mechanics, it offers a level of security that traditional methods cannot match. This technology is still in its infancy, but its potential applications are vast, ranging from secure banking transactions to protecting sensitive government communications. As research continues, we can expect to see more practical implementations of quantum cryptography in the near future.
